Black Water Extraction (Category 3) Cost in Desoto, GA

The cost of Black Water Extraction (Category 3) can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Desoto, GA. Here are some estimated price ranges:

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Assessment and Containment $500 – $2,500 Severity of damage, size of affected area
Water Extraction $1,000 – $5,000 Size of affected area, type of equipment needed
Drying and Dehumidification $500 – $2,000 Size of affected area, type of equipment needed
Cleaning and Sanitizing $1,000 – $3,000 Size of affected area, type of equipment needed
Restoration $2,000 – $10,000 Size of affected area, type of materials needed
Equipment Rental $100 – $500 Size of affected area, type of equipment needed

Q: What is Black Water Extraction (Category 3)?

A: Black Water Extraction (Category 3) refers to the process of removing Category 3 water from a home or building. Category 3 water is contaminated with sewage, chemicals, or other hazardous materials. This is a serious issue that needs prompt attention.
